2.2.4 Other types of I/O
2.2.4.1 High Speed Counters

High Speed Counters receive pulses at a high rate of speed. These pulses may indicate the speed or position of a motor or other revolving or linear device. High Speed Counters are typically used with encoders and have other features such as inputs for homing signals and interrupts.

2.2.4.2 Decoders

Decoders receive analog rotary position information from resolvers to provide angular position and velocity for a rotating axis. The input is typically a sinusoidal waveform in the millivolt range. Like High Speed Counters, there are usually other input and output points available associated with the axis.
